CodeWiser is an AI-powered development tool designed to assist programmers with writing, debugging, and optimizing code. It leverages advanced machine learning models and natural language processing (NLP) to understand code context, offering real-time suggestions, error detection, and automated refactoring tips.
The platform is compatible with multiple programming languages and integrates seamlessly with popular code editors and IDEs. Whether you’re working on a small personal project or a large-scale application, CodeWiser enhances productivity by automating common coding tasks and providing instant feedback. It’s like having a coding mentor by your side, making development faster, easier, and more enjoyable.

Is CodeWiser Free?
Yes, CodeWiser offers both a free plan and premium subscription options:
CodeWiser Pricing Plans
- Free Plan: Limited access to code suggestions, basic bug detection features, supports up to 1 programming language, community support access.
- Starter Plan for $10/month: Full access to code suggestions and debugging features, supports 5 programming languages, integration with popular IDEs (VS Code, IntelliJ), email support.
- Pro Plan for $25/month: Unlimited language support, advanced code refactoring and optimization tools, priority customer support, access to premium AI features for complex coding tasks.
- Enterprise Plan for $100/month: Team collaboration tools, custom IDE integrations, real-time project tracking, dedicated account manager and support.
CodeWiser Pros & Cons
Pros
- Accelerates coding by offering real-time suggestions and optimizations
- Supports multiple programming languages for versatility
- Seamless integration with popular IDEs for a smooth workflow
- Advanced debugging tools that save valuable development time
- AI-driven suggestions for better code quality and fewer bugs
Cons
- Limited functionality in the free plan, which may restrict heavy users
- AI-generated suggestions require some review and validation
- Premium plans can be expensive for solo developers or small businesses
- Occasional lag in processing large codebases or complex projects
- Some advanced features are only available in higher-tier plans
